From 7a252b6a470f77e874bfe52de8b8d849c62ea4e4 Mon Sep 17 00:00:00 2001 From: Henrik Lissner Date: Tue, 28 May 2019 17:02:10 -0400 Subject: [PATCH] Refactor pyimport def-package! block --- modules/lang/python/config.el | 26 +++++++++++--------------- 1 file changed, 11 insertions(+), 15 deletions(-) diff --git a/modules/lang/python/config.el b/modules/lang/python/config.el index ecea8d652..688bf5bb1 100644 --- a/modules/lang/python/config.el +++ b/modules/lang/python/config.el @@ -94,6 +94,17 @@ called.") "u" #'anaconda-mode-find-references)) +(def-package! pyimport + :after python + :config + (map! :map python-mode-map + :localleader + (:prefix ("i" . "insert") + :desc "Missing imports" "m" #'pyimport-insert-missing) + (:prefix ("r" . "remove") + :desc "Unused imports" "r" #'pyimport-remove-unused))) + + (def-package! nose :commands nose-mode :preface (defvar nose-mode-map (make-sparse-keymap)) @@ -206,18 +217,3 @@ called.") (add-to-list 'global-mode-string '(conda-env-current-name (" conda:" conda-env-current-name " ")) 'append)) - - -;; Import managements -(def-package! pyimport - :after python - :init - (map! :after python - :map 'python-mode-map - :localleader - (:prefix ("i" . "insert") - :desc "Missing imports" "m" #'pyimport-insert-missing) - (:prefix ("r" . "remove") - :desc "Unused imports" "r" #'pyimport-remove-unused) - ) - )